We stopped by the friends and family portion of the Rag & Bone sample sale this morning, and if the line outside was any indication of what's to come when the doors officially open to the public at 10:30am tomorrow, then you're in for a crowded and hectic shopping experience. As expected, the door policy for today's sale is lax, and the general public is allowed to enter. (Sale ends at 8pm.)
As always, the sale is stocked with wear-now merchandise for both men and women, with price lists posted in the corresponding areas, so be sure to double-check the signs. Divided between two levels, the menswear and denim bar are on the lower level and womenswear is on the upper level. Most styles are available in multiple sizes, except for women's sweaters, which were primarily smaller sizes.
For the ladies, you will be happy to know that the shoe station was well stocked with sizes and styles, from quilted loafers to black pony Newbury boots priced between $150-$295. Small and large Pilot bags for $250-$350 are scattered around the accessory shelves among the pinstripe alpaca scarves, iPad cases, and wallets (all for $65).
Outerwear includes parkas with quilted lining, classic pea coats with leather details, and oversized wool coats for $350-$450. Fleece lined jean jackets, navy pinstripe blazers, and textured bomber jackets are $195-$250. Leather pieces run high on the price scale, with leather shorts for $250, leather skirts for $350, and leather pants for $595—although the quilted leather pants we saw were splurge worthy.
The denim bar offers mostly skinny silhouettes in an array of blue washes, a camouflage print, and white denim with black panels for $98. Jeans with leather details are $150.
There are separate fitting rooms for men and women, with a maximum of six items at a time and insistence to leave your Rag and Bone accessories and shoes outside. We only saw one mirror outside the dressing room with women trying on coats among their piles of merchandise.
For men, the outerwear selection is great, with wardrobe staples including long army green military coats, anoraks with fur trimmed hoods, and navy peacoats with shearling collars, all priced between $350 and $450. There's no shortage of men's leather jackets, from classic black jackets and mineral green bombers to a red and navy moto jacket for $595. Shawl collar cardigans and pullover sweaters for $150 were neatly stacked on tables among the racks of outerwear. Denim is $98.
Men's shoes are limited, but boots, brogues, and boat shoes are $195, while sneakers are only $125, with some sizes available in select styles. Hand tailored suit jackets ($595) and pants ($195) from the Greenfield collection make an appearance in black and grey. Button up shirts ($98) with checks, plaids, and stripes fill the center table of the men's section. Solid styles in chambray, flannel, and light weight cotton are also stacked high in most sizes.
As usual, this sale get insanely crowded, so allow enough time and patience to deal with the mob scene. The sale will run from 10:30am to 8pm tomorrow through Friday, from 11am to 6pm on Saturday, and from 10am to 3pm on Sunday.—Christina DeSmet
